Abstract

DHF is one of the widespread infectious diseases in Indonesia, with an increased infected number of sufferers. DHF case is closely related to environmental sanitation, wich causes the availability of breeding places for the Aedes aegypti mosquito vectors. The study was to determine the relationship between environmental sanitation behavior and the case of DHF in the working area of the Tarus Community Health Center in 2020. The study design was descriptive-analytical with a cross-sectional study approach. The sample was_99 respondents taken by simple random sampling technique. Data was collected from interviews and analyzed using the Chi-square test. The results showed that the varuabels of knowledge (p = 0.000), attitudes (p = 0.021), and actions to environmental sanitation (p = 0.000) were related to the DHF case. The Tarus Community Health Center should increase outreach activities and family empowerment efforts related to the prevention and control of DHF.

Abstract

Vaginal discharge is one of the reproductive health issues experienced by female university students. This research aimed to describe the attitudes and actions of preventing and overcoming pathological vaginal discharge on female students in the Faculty of Public Health, Nusa Cendana University, Kupang. This was qualitative research, with six female students as informants obtained by purposive sampling technique. The results showed that the informants' attitude included feelings of fear and not fear of vaginal discharge experienced, and positive responses to the importance of actions of preventing and overcoming vaginal discharge. Pathological vaginal discharge precaution was generally undertaken by maintaining the hygiene of reproductive organs, while the act of overcoming pathological vaginal discharge was by using traditional methods and seeking treatment at health facilities. Female college students should have more information about vaginal discharge to prevent and overcome effectively the issue.

Abstract

Maternal mortality according to World Health Organization is death during pregnancy or within a period of 42 days after the end of pregnancy, due to all causes related to or aggravated by pregnancy or its handling, but not due to accident or injury. The causes of maternal death can be divided into two groups, namely direct obstetric death and indirect obstetric death. One of the efforts to reduce the Maternal Mortality Rate (MMR) is by providing standard Antenatal Care (ANC) services. This research aims to describe the characteristics of mothers in Antenatal Care examinations at the pubic health center of Pasir Panjang, Kupang City. This type of research used a descriptive design with a population of all K4 pregnant women register data at the pubic health center of Pasir Panjang in January-December 2019 as many as 403 pregnant women. Sampling using a total sampling technique of 403 pregnant women. The results showed that the characteristics of mothers according to age were in the 20-35 year old group (83.4%), parity in the nulliparous group (45.9%), residence in Pasir Panjang village (33.5%), history of maternal ANC visits according to the consecutive trimester of age Trimester I (98,1%), Trimester II (88,1%), and Trimester III (90.3%).

Abstract

Exclusive breast milk is breast milk given to infants up to six months of age without giving any food or additional fluids. Tena Teke Primary Health Care (PHC) has low coverage of exclusive breastmilk as only 45% babies receiving the breastmilk; this percentage is under the national target of 80%. The research aimed to analyze the relationship between work, cultural values, childbirth assistance and family support with exclusive breastfeeding at Tena Teke PHC. This research was a quantitative study with a cross-sectional design. The sample consisted of 75 people selected using a simple random sampling technique. Data were analyzed using the chi square test with the significance level of α=0.05. The study found that the variable of maternal occupation (p=0.013), maternal cultural values (p=0.000), maternal birth attendant (p=0.003) and maternal family support (p=0.000) were associated with exclusive breastfeeding. Mothers who still actively work need to manage time to breastfeed their babies. Mothers are also encouraged to access information related to the benefits of exclusive breastfeeding to change the existing cultural perceptions about the traditions hindering exclusive breastfeeding practice.

Abstract

Menstrual cycle disorder is a disorder experienced by a woman during the menstrual period, characterized by prolongation of the menstrual cycle (oligomenorrhea), shortening of the menstrual cycle (polimenorrhea) or the absence of menstruation for 3 to 6 consecutive months (secondary amenorrhea), even non-occurrence menstruation after going through puberty (primary amenorrhea). This study aims to analyze the relationship between body weight, diet, physical activity and stress levels with menstrual cycle disorders in Faculty of Medicine University of Nusa Cendana students. This type of research is a quantitative study using a cross-sectional study approach. The study population was all 154 medical students class 2017-2019 and the sample was determined by using simple random sampling technique as many as 111 people. The data analysis used was univariate and bivariate analysis using the Chi-square test. The results showed that there was a relationship between body weight, physical activity and stress level with menstrual cycle disorders and there was no relationship between diet and menstrual cycle disorders. It is recommended that Faculty of Medicine University of Nusa Cendana students prevent menstrual cycle disorders from now on by maintaining a normal body weight, doing physical activity according to the body's needs and being able to manage stress, especially academic stress during their education.
